Arsenal have shown robust form in the Premier League, soaring with an intensity that’s hard to ignore. Their attacking flair, coupled with a relatively stable backline, makes them prime candidates for your FPL squad. Key players such as Bukayo Saka, Gabriel Martinelli, and Martin Ødegaard have been consistently racking up the points, showcasing why having triple Arsenal representation could be a game changer. Saka and Martinelli, with their forward thrusts and goal involvement, are quintessential for those looking to bank on offensive points. Meanwhile, Ødegaard, serving as the creative linchpin, frequently finds ways to contribute through goals or assists.

But why stop at picking these players? Understanding underlying stats like expected goals (xG), expected assists (xA), and clean sheet probabilities can further refine your choices. For instance, analyzing opposition weaknesses and anticipating which Arsenal player is likelier to exploit them can enhance your team selection’s effectiveness. Similarly, keeping an eye on Haaland’s shot conversion rate and involvement in goal-scoring opportunities can reassure you of your captaincy decision.
Moreover, staying updated with the latest team news, such as injuries and rotations, could be crucial. A sudden absence of a key player may shift the dynamics drastically, influencing both Arsenal's output and Haaland’s opportunities. Regular monitoring of press conferences and reliable FPL sources will keep you ahead in your decision-making process.
